Alas, my windows are swing-open jobs with screens attached on the outside. The particular one that was broken in had a teensy little latch at the bottom but otherwise was two windows that swing open like this: \__/ The bottom latch was mostly loose, so the guy removed the outer screen, then basically pushed really hard until the bottom and center latches gave way.

There's not a really easy way to block them up, so what we did was add an additional latch hooking them together more tightly, and wire through the top curtain area to tie it shut, and the landlords have a contractor in to provide a more permanent and pleasant solution.
